ROXY MUSIC WITH BRIAN FERRY
EL CAMPELLO
July 30th 2005

Still Rockin'

 

I hate to admit this, but the last time I saw Ferry and Roxy Music was sometime around 1976 at the Albert Hall... That was one great gig!

 

So, El Campello, somewhere close to Alicante, a one day music fest with Roxy headlining, mmmm....

 

El Campello was the penultimate stop in the European tour to show the world that Roxy music can still do it. No new Album to promote - although they are said to be recording one as we speak. So it seems that this is just a tour for the fun of it. And fun they had!

 

They all look pretty good, besuited and very business-like, The stage is soon filled with a suprising number of people including the core band, Brian Ferry, Phil Manzanera, Andy Mackay, Chris Spedding, Paul Thomson and assorted others including two great ladies on Percussion, keyboards and a great electric Violin (Louise Peacock), a couple of great backing Vocalists and some (not so great) Bluebell type dancers.

 

Ferry hasn't changed, the trademark sharp suit and the moves are all still there (he still does that slow dig move!) but it is very definitely a Roxy show and it's mainy the early catalogue starting with re-make/re-model.

 

As I said earlier, the emphasis was on fun, the band were clearly enjoying themselves and so were the very healthy crowd. Lot's of Brits in the audience - of a certain age - I was probably sitting with some of them in the Albert Hall all those years ago...

Andy Mackay plays great sax, Manzanera and Spedding both play great guitar, and the entire band are extremely tight.

Highlights of the evening for me were Virginia Plain, Jealous Guy and Do the Strand, the encore. The crowd tried and tried to get them back for another Otra! but one was enough, hey, that's ok, they aren't young men any more!

Roxy Music set list -
Re-make/Re-model, Street Life, Out Of The Blue, Ladytron, A Song For Europe, My Only Love, Both Ends Burning, Tara, In Every Dreamhome A Heartache, The Bogus Man, Jealous Guy, Pyjamarama, Editions Of You, Virginia Plain, Love Is The Drug, Do The Strand.
